Hey, I messed up the front fork of my Yamaha R1 when I built it! Glad I'm not the only one.... I put some part (I think the lower peice that goes between the shocks and you use to screw the fork to the frame) on upside down and it wasn't apparent until it was time to mate the fork with the bike. By that time the glue had mostly taken and I had to break it before I could fix it. It looks ok now, but it sure was frustrating.
